For those that don't also follow the dev@ list, there is meanwhile one 
way with about 40,000 nodes, which has prompted people to discuss ways 
to stop mappers creating these giants. The existing large ways will be 
dealt with in one way or another; more than a few thousand is surely not 
ok because it creates problems on many fronts.

Jochen has today built a large way check into the OSM Inspector, so you 
can see where the ways with more than 1,000 nodes are:

http://tools.geofabrik.de/osmi/?view=geometry .
